Landlord Insurance Coverage!

All those contents which is owned by the landlord and used by the tenants such as white goods and others will definitely be covered under landlord insurance. The cost of policy is based on the value of contents which you wish to insure. It is important to remember that you declare the value of your property you are actually estimating the cost of rebuilding it, should it be totally destroyed. In case of landlord content insurance, the contents that you can insure are items that you own in the property but which may become damaged such as carpets, sofas, tables, chairs and pictures if you are renting the property as furnished. Some insurers also insure communal contents which will cover contents such as those names above which are situated in communal areas in blocks of flats, or properties with multiple types of tenants.
